LOS ANGELES DODGERS HAVE BEEN GOOD AGAINST THE NL WEST

Heading into today’s game, the Dodgers are 1st in the NL West with an overall record of 62-45. When looking at their performance in their 33 series, Los Angeles is 19-13-1. Against below .500 teams, the Dodgers are 28-28 while going 28-25 on the road and 34-20 at home.

Los Angeles starter Bobby Miller has put together an impressive 6-2 record this season, accompanied by a 4.37 ERA. His road ERA of 2.60 is especially noteworthy, while his home ERA of 6.31 is less impressive. Miller’s WHIP for the season stands at 1.19 and opposing teams have only managed to hit .230 against him with a slugging percentage of .385.

Bobby Miller’s most recent start ended in a 6-5 defeat for the Dodgers at the hands of the Reds. The right-hander yielded three runs on six hits across five frames.

Having gone deep 8 times in their last five games, the Dodgers are 4th in that span. At 5.6 runs per game, Los Angeles is 2nd in the league. This figure has come on a team batting average of .249 while hitting a total of 174 home runs (2nd).

Freddie Freeman has been a key contributor to the Los Angeles offense this season, boasting a .341 batting average and .598 slugging percentage. Over the team’s past ten games, Freeman has been even more impressive, leading the Dodgers in hits and batting an impressive .477.

WILL THE SAN DIEGO PADRES TAKE CARE OF BUSINESS AT HOME?

The Padres will be looking for their 3rd straight win in today’s game and have an overall record of 54-55. At home, San Diego has put together a record of 29-25 while going 25-30 on the road. Currently, they are in 4th place in the NL West.

Yu Darvish will take the mound for San Diego with an 8-7 record. The right-hander has made 19 appearances this season, posting a 4.53 ERA and 9.81 K/9 rate. His FIP is at 4.11, while his OBP sits at .311.

Yu Darvish notched a victory and a quality start in his last outing, guiding his squad to a 4-0 triumph over the Rangers. The right-hander yielded no runs and three hits over six frames.

For the season, the Padres’ offense is averaging 4.6 runs per game. Over their last ten games they have swung the bats well, sitting 6th in the league in scoring, with a total of 50 runs. Overall, San Diego’s team batting average is .240, putting them 16th in the MLB.

The Padres’ offensive leader, Xander Bogaerts, has been a reliable presence at the plate this season. He currently holds a .266 batting average and has put up an impressive .396 slugging percentage and .344 on-base percentage.
